(The Girl in the Fog) is a 2017 Italian psychological thriller directed by Donato Carrisi in his directorial debut, based on his own bestselling novel of the same name. Plot Overview

Donato Carrisi draws inspiration from directors like David Lynch, David Fincher, and Giuseppe Tornatore. The film utilizes a "claustrophobic" and creepy mountain atmosphere to build tension.

As the media frenzy grows, Vogel focuses his suspicion on (Alessio Boni), a local high school teacher with financial troubles who has recently moved to the village with his daughter. The film is structured through flashbacks and a frame narrative involving a psychiatrist, Dr. Flores (Jean Reno), who evaluates Vogel after a car accident that occurs months after the investigation. The film was generally well-received for its strong performances—particularly Servillo and Boni—and its atmospheric storytelling. While some viewers found the ending polarizing or "unsatisfying," it is widely regarded as a standout modern European thriller.
